Boston College vs FSU

Compare two rival schools - Boston College and Florida State University with tuition and admission information where Boston College is a four-years, private (not-for-profit) located in Chestnut Hill, MA and FSU is a four-years, public located in Tallahassee, FL.
The next list compares two colleges briefly in important perspectives. You can compare two colleges with comprehensive information on the full comparison page.
  • Boston College is a private (not-for-profit) and FSU is a public school and both are four-years schools.
  • Boston College has more expensive tuition & fees ($67,680) than FSU ($18,786).
  • It is harder to admit to Boston College than FSU.
  • Boston College has a higher submitted SAT score (1,490) than FSU (1,290).
  • Boston College has higher submitted ACT score (34) than FSU (29).
  • FSU has more students with 44,161 students while Boston College has 15,287 students.
  • Boston College has a lower number of students per faculty with 12 to 1 while FSU's ratio is 17 to 1.
  • FSU has more full-time faculties with 1,631 faculties while Boston College has 882 full-time faculties.
